1: Facebook
About
Facebook is the leader on the online social networking space, coming in at number 1 on the VegiBit list of top websites for social networking. The website has grown from its early beginnings at Harvard University when Mark Zuckerburg first created the service. After beginning as a website for higher education students only, Facebook has opened its doors to the world and now boasts over a billion users making it one of the biggest websites on the entire internet!
Pros
It’s easy to join! Setting up your profile is an easy process, and the uncluttered interface of the site is easy to use. The website is free and all you need is an internet connection and your computer to become a member.
Cons
Privacy has long been a concern at Facebook. Privacy: It’s really important to grasp the website’s privacy settings and set them as needed. Much has been done in recent years to improve the site’s security, but it can still be confusing. Website: http://www.facebook.com
2: Twitter
About
Twitter is an online social networking and microblogging website that gives users the ability to post and read “tweets”, which are micro updates sort to speak limited to 140 characters. Only registered users can read and post tweets while unregistered users can only read the various messages. Users of the site access the service through the website interface, SMS, or mobile app such as on the Apple iPhone. Twitter is located in San Francisco with offices in New York City, Boston, and San Antonio. Twitter is gaining ground rapidly and in my opinion is the most fun of the top 10 websites for social networking.
Pros
Every tweet you post goes to all of your followers. Facebook on the other hand uses something called Edgerank which will limit your post to only some of your fans.
Cons
With Twitter users generating over 340 million tweets a day, your tweets could be quickly buried in your followers’ feeds. Website: http://www.twitter.com

8: Reddit
About
Reddit is a social news and entertainment site where registered users submit links to content which the community votes on. Users can then vote submissions “up” or “down” to rank the post and determine its position on the website. Content posts are organized by areas of interest called subreddits.
Pros
Super engaged community that takes content curation seriously.
Cons
Can sometimes feel hostile due to the same seriousness of content curation. Website: http://www.reddit.com
9: Instagram
About
Instagram is an online photo sharing, and social networking service now owned by Facebook. Since the Instagram experience is unique, we still chose to give it recognition on out top 10 list. Users can take pictures and videos, apply digital filters to them, and share them on a variety of social networking services, such as Facebook, Twitter, and Tumblr. The instagram Filters feature become such a hit, that many other services like Twitter also now offer this type of feature.
